1.Power reset the printer
On the operator panel, press and hold the button for one second. (The display will go blank.)
Note: It may be necessary to unplug the power cord if pressing the ON/OFF button does not shut off the printer.
Wait approximately ten seconds and then press the button again.
Wait until the device has completed its cycling process before submitting another job request.
2.Service Reset:
On the operator panel, press and hold the button for one second to power off the printer. (The display will go blank.)
Note: It may be necessary to unplug the power cord if pressing the ON/OFF button does not shut off the printer.
Confirm the printer is not on and then unplug the power cord from the back of the printer.
If the power cord was disconnected (as stated in step 1) in order to shut off the printer, go to step 3.
Press the button repeatedly five times.
Re-connect the power cord.
Press the button to power the printer back on.
Wait until the device has completed its cycling process before submitting another job request.
Important:
This procedure will not resolve a physical hardware issue.
For example, a paper clip is wedged between the paper feed rollers or gears; or, the scanner assembly is detached from the inside housing.
This procedure will not resolve all service errors or LCD related anomalies.
Service errors appear as four characters (a combination of alpha and numeric codes).

Check that there is no residual tape on the cartridges.
Then clean the contacts (the hole where the ink comes out) on the cartridges as well as inside the printer itself
NOTE: Clean the contacts with a small amount of warm water on a cotton swab until no ink comes off on the swab.
If any of the other cartridges are low, empty, leaking or bulging, replace them with genuine and original ones.
Then turn off the machine and unplug it for 60 seconds
Insert the cartridges and check to see if the issue persists
